Meet Tweety: this gorgeous Pitty Mix girl could have been called "lucky" - she was found abandoned by one of our fosters and taken in. After no owner was found, she was fully vetted and integrated into the household. She is young and sweet, loves playing with the fosters families other dogs and enjoys hanging out with the HighSchool aged kids. She is respectful of items left on counters IF not left unattended for too long, she is quickly learning to copy the resident dogs and well, they are less respectful. Tweety is a genuine sweetheart and according to her foster family: "the only thing bigger than her ears is her heart"

Tweety is crate trained, rides well in the car and is working on leash manners. She is looking for a home where she can be part of the family, she can be left alone crated, but it's not her favorite. Lounging on the sofa or playing ball with the

Twyla's Friends's Adoption Policy
Thank you for your interest in adopting a Dog from Twyla’s Friends. Our main objective is to find the right match for the dog and the family, matching energy levels and expectations to facilitate a successful adoption. We aim to line up our priorities of Safety, Health, and Comfort of the dog with the expectations and lifestyle of the family. Adoption Application can be filled out online here:  http://www.twyla.org/adopt/adoption-application We require a securely fenced-in yard, current animals in the household must be vaccinated, altered and on heartworm prevention. Our process includes a veterinary reference check and a home visit, so adoptions are limited to the driveable greater Houston area.
